Здравствуйте, интересует вопрос, а можно ли вытащить информацию о приложении из офф API Google Play, если приложение не является моим. Мне бы хотелось вытащить например кто владелец, Версия приложения, название и тд.
Я для себя сделал сервисный аккаунт и попробовал использовать google-api-python-client и google-auth.
Код по идее должен вытаскивать последние отзывы приложения, но выбрасывает ошибку:
googleapiclient.errors.HttpError: <HttpError 403 when requesting https://www.googleapis.com/androidpublisher/v2/applications/com.ea.game.nfs14_row/reviews?alt=json returned "The project id used to call the Google Play Developer API has not been linked in the Google Play Developer Console.">
Если я правильно понимаю, нельзя выташить информацию, поскольку мой сервисный аккаунт никак не относится к приложению.
Python код:
import apiclient
from google.oauth2 import service_account
SCOPES = ['https://www.googleapis.com/auth/androidpublisher']
credentials = service_account.Credentials.from_service_account_file('client_secret.json', scopes=SCOPES)
service = apiclient.discovery.build('games','v1',credentials=credentials)
items = service.applications().get(applicationId='com.ea.game.nfs14_row').execute()
for data in items:
print(data)